Arsenal Broke The Deadlock By Beating Chelsea 3-1 At The Emirates Stadium. Gunners eased the pressure on manager Mikel Arteta with a 3-1 home win over Chelsea to bring their winless Premier League run to an end.
Alexandre Lacazette converted a penalty before Granit Xhaka’s superb free-kick doubled Arsenal’s lead just ahead of the break.
Chelsea, looking to stay hot on the heels of the chasing pack, were caught out again after 56 minutes when Bukayo Saka clipped home a third, sending Chelsea plans for win to the shadow.

Mohamed Elneny drilled a fierce effort against the crossbar, before Chelsea pulled a goal back after 85 minutes through Tammy Abraham, who was ruled onside by VAR after initially being flagged offside.
Gunners keeper Bernd Leno produced a fine save from Jorginho’s penalty in stoppage time as Arsenal closed out a first league win since beating Manchester United away last month.
